Best Online Shops to Buy Edible Flowers in the UK

Several reputable online shops in the UK provide a wide selection of edible flowers. Stores like Nurtured in Norfolk, Westlands UK, Fine Food Specialist, and Yorkshire Edible Flowers offer fresh, dried, and pressed flowers delivered directly to your door. Online shopping ensures convenience, access to rare flowers, and the option to order in bulk for weddings or events.

Online stores also stock complementary edible decorations, including edible glitter, rice paper, and wafer paper. These items can enhance cakes, drinks, and desserts in a professional or creative way. In addition to online options, many supermarkets and craft stores in the UK sell edible flowers. Marks & Spencer, Sainsbury’s, Hobbycraft, and Lakeland often carry fresh or dried flowers in their food or baking sections. Local florists and farmers’ markets are also excellent sources for seasonal edible flowers that are safe and food-grade.

When shopping in-store, it is crucial to check for freshness and proper labelling. Organic and certified food-safe flowers are the best choice. Tips for Choosing and Using Edible Flowers Safely

Food safety is a key concern when using edible flowers. Always select flowers that are certified food-grade or organic. Avoid flowers from unknown sources or those treated with pesticides. Proper storage, such as keeping flowers refrigerated or dried, ensures they maintain freshness and flavour for longer periods.

Matching edible flowers with the right recipes is also essential. Rose petals are excellent for desserts and tea, while pansies and violets work well as garnishes for drinks and cocktails.
